Description

The Line Service Technician (LST) is responsible for providing safe efficient aircraft ground handling services while delivering exceptional customer service to aircraft owners guests and flight crews. This role is hands on and operations focused supporting all arriving and departing aircraft with professionalism urgency and a positive attitude.

Aircraft Ground Handling and Ramp Operations

  • Perform aircraft fueling towing parking de icing placement and basic cleaning
  • Operate a wide range of aircraft ground support equipment in accordance with procedures and safety standards
  • Ensure timely and accurate delivery of all required ground support services for arriving and departing aircraft
  • Maintain continuous ramp awareness including aircraft movement FOD prevention and changing weather conditions
  • Perform duties with attention to detail and minimal supervision

Safety and Compliance

  • Promote safe operations by protecting customers employees aircraft and equipment from harm
  • Follow all company policies standard operating procedures and safety regulations
  • Use sound judgment when making timely decisions during active operations
  • Support a safety focused culture by maintaining awareness of ramp hazards and operational risks

Customer Service and Experience

  • Deliver Modern Aviations exceptional service by assisting passengers and flight crews with professionalism and care
  • Greet customers with high energy a positive attitude and a willingness to exceed expectations
  • Anticipate customer needs offer additional services and represent Modern Aviation in a professional manner
  • Maintain a positive image with customers vendors partners and airport stakeholders

Communication and Teamwork

  • Work effectively with other Line Service Technicians Customer Service staff and Operations leadership
  • Communicate clearly during aircraft movements and active operations
  • Perform additional duties as assigned by Shift Leads or Line Management

Physical Requirements and Schedule

  • Ability to stand or walk for extended periods of time
  • Physical capability to perform frequent bending reaching and manual tasks
  • Must meet physical demands associated with ramp operations
  • Able to work variable shifts including nights weekends and holidays as required


Qualifications
  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• Must be at least 18 years of age
  • Must have open availability as work schedules vary including evenings and weekends
  • Valid drivers license
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ills
  • Strong mathematical aptitude
  • Previous customer service experience preferred
  • Basic knowledge of aircraft types and aircraft servicing practices preferred

Working conditions and physical demands for this role

While performing the duties of this job the employee is regularly exposed to moving mechanical parts. The employee is exposed to wet and/or humid conditions including extreme heat and cold; high precarious places; outside weather conditions and vibration; and chemicals including aviation fuels oils and lavatory fluid. The noise level in the work environment is usually loud.
